Discover the beauty of Lake Thun while paddling a canoe or a stand-up paddleboard (SUP). Look into its deep-blue waters and admire the majestic mountain panorama from the lake. You can paddle by canoe or SUP to Faulensee or even Spiez and conclude your excursion there.

Bootswerft Wilke is renowned for constructing sailing boats used by Olympic and World champions Bootswerft Wilke is situated directly on the shore of the lake in Leissigen and hires out canoes, sit-on-top canoes and stand-up paddleboards.

Enjoy a trip in a canoe and paddle to Faulensee either on your own or with your friends or family. On the way, why not take a break at the lido or the Blue Turtle in Faulensee and treat yourself to a refreshing drink or ice cream. Discover the most beautiful stretches of the shoreline and picturesque bays from the water, go ashore to sunbathe or cool off with a dip in the water. Discover Lake Thun and enjoy the majestic mountain panorama while sitting in a canoe or standing on a stand-up paddleboard.

To ensure that your trip is perfect in every way, please note

  • Seasonal opening times
  • Bring your swimsuit and some dry clothes
  • Sunscreen and a sun hat to protect your skin
  • Paddles, life jackets and watertight bags are included in the hire cost
  • Scheduled passenger ferries have priority
